Lady Texans fall to Liberty in state semifinals 4-0

Liberty pitcher throws no-hitter to advance to state title game

CALDWELL— The Lady Texan’s season is over.

After a great 29-8-2 season, the Wimberley High School softball team faced a tough 37-6 Liberty High School team, led by ace pitcher Bayleigh Taylor, who was solid again from the circle during the University Interscholastic League Class 4A Softball Semifinal match up at Caldwell High School in Caldwell last Thursday night. Taylor threw a no-hitter to lead the Lady Panthers to a 4-0 win, advancing to the Class 4A Division II State Championship to face Brock High School.

At Thursday’s game in Caldwell, after two scoreless innings, Liberty scored a run in the bottom of the third for a 1-0 lead.

Liberty’s Kaylin Heuitt took a ball to open the frame, and then, ripped a line drive triple to left field.

Taylor then came up to bat and drove the first pitch down the third base line to single and score Heuitt from third.

The Wimberley defense then shut Liberty down in the inning, despite having bases loaded.

The fourth inning was scoreless for both teams.

Then, in the bottom of the fifth, Liberty’s Kylee Bishop opened up the frame with a single to center and advanced to second on a Wimberley error.

Lady Panther Kinley Brashier then hit a ground out to advance Bishop to third.

Liberty’s Abbie Key then hit a long fly ball over the center field fence to extend the Lady Panters’ lead to 3-0.

In the top of the sixth, Wimberley’s Emorie Gahan reached base with two outs after hitting a ground ball to third and the Liberty third baseman committing an error. However, Liberty’s Taylor struck out the next Wimberley batter with three pitches for the third out.

The Lady Panthers scored their final run in the bottom of the sixth.

Liberty’s Izzy Reyes started the inning with a single to short.

Then, Heuitt singled to short to advance Reyes to second.

With Liberty’s Taylor up to bat, both base runners advanced a base on a passed ball. Then, Taylor walked to load the bases.

Liberty’s Bishop then lined out to Wimberley left fielder Ansley Davis who made a spectacular catch -- keeping the runners on base.

Lady Panther Brashier then grounded into a fielder’s choice with Wimberley shortstop Ella Patek throwing home for the force out of Reyes.

Liberty then put Marley Mouton in the game as a courtesy runner for Taylor.

With two outs and the bases still loaded, Heuitt scored on a passed ball with the other base runners advancing to second and third. However, Wimberley was able to pick off Mouton in a hot box along the third base line for the third out.

In the top of the seventh with one out, Wimberley was able to get a baserunner on first when Reagan Kenley was hit by a pitch.

However, the Liberty defense held her at first with a fly ball out to center and Taylor striking out the final Wimberley batter of the game.
